Record 1, Textual support, English
Record number: 1, Textual support number: 1 DEF
An oil burner which delivers fuel oil to the combustion zone in the form of tiny droplets. 2, record 1, English, - atomizing%20oil%20burner
Record number: 1, Textual support number: 1 CONT
The atomizing type of burner prepares the oil for burning by breaking it up into a fog-like vapor. This is accomplished in three ways :(1) by forcing the oil under pressure through a nozzle air or steam may be forced through with the oil, or the oil may be forced alone or(2) by allowing the oil to flow out the end of small tubes that are rapidly rotated on a distributor, or(3) by forcing the oil off the edge of a rapidly rotating cup that may be mounted either vertically or horizontally. 3, record 1, English, - atomizing%20oil%20burner

Record 2, Textual support, English
Record number: 2, Textual support number: 1 DEF
Steel made directly from cast iron, by burning out a portion of the carbon and other impurities that the latter contains, through the agency of a blast of air which is forced through the molten metal. 2, record 2, English, - Bessemer%20steel
